A prism is a transparent optical element with flat, polished surfaces that can refract, reflect, and disperse light. Its main function is to separate white light into its different colors, known as dispersion, and to bend or redirect light rays. Prisms are commonly used in optical devices like cameras, binoculars, and spectrometers.

The different colors of light are separated by a prism due to a process called dispersion. This is because each color of light has a different wavelength, causing them to bend at slightly different angles as they pass through the prism, resulting in the splitting of white light into its constituent colors.
To separate rainbow colors individually, you can use a prism or a diffraction grating. When white light passes through a prism or a diffraction grating, the different wavelengths of light (colors) are refracted at different angles, causing them to separate. This results in the dispersion of light into its constituent colors of the rainbow.
